Mark,
        You can try freeware TACACS+ (see link below). I personally
prefer it over Cisco ACS. I'll take editing the tacacs configuration
with vi over a not so great web interface any day ;-) Lastly I've
noticed in production that the authentication process is faster with
freeware TACACS+ than Cisco ACS.
